Transaction 25f4f0688960391c9b08905fbe5a4945d1dc3f204652b3be7bf68595b662230e
1 Input
1 Output
-
25f4f0688960391c9b08905fbe5a4945d1dc3f204652b3be7bf68595b662230e:0
- value
- 21099530000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a947616696bdaa7cc10e2406f4cd5de6a8005341 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GS4i2FBd3s8xUmTQoteRBm2ZVsbWtCe5y